The CDRfix4/5/6 omnibus cdr fixes.
commitc82ae1f18071577f41506db75b06011ec79d2fa5
authormurf <murf@614ede4d-c843-0410-af14-a771ab80d22e>
Thu, 3 Jul 2008 00:16:25 +0000 (3 00:16 +0000)
committermurf <murf@614ede4d-c843-0410-af14-a771ab80d22e>
Thu, 3 Jul 2008 00:16:25 +0000 (3 00:16 +0000)
treef2c79c5941fdf5b648ecb85706407379e93a3dd4
parentc0a0c4ca2157d0674f71607e13cde2e18ca7f8f2
The CDRfix4/5/6 omnibus cdr fixes.

(closes issue #10927)
Reported by: murf
Tested by: murf, deeperror

(closes issue #12907)
Reported by: falves11
Tested by: murf, falves11

(closes issue #11849)
Reported by: greyvoip

As to 11849, I think these changes fix the core problems
brought up in that bug, but perhaps not the more global
problems created by the limitations of CDR's themselves
not being oriented around transfers.

Reopen if necc, but bug reports are not the best
medium for enhancement discussions. We need to start
a second-generation CDR standardization effort to cover
transfers.

(closes issue #11093)
Reported by: rossbeer
Tested by: greyvoip, murf

git-svn-id: http://svn.digium.com/svn/asterisk/branches/1.4@127663 614ede4d-c843-0410-af14-a771ab80d22e
channels/chan_dahdi.c
channels/chan_sip.c
include/asterisk/cdr.h
main/cdr.c
main/channel.c
main/pbx.c
res/res_features.c